On Tue, Mar 16, 2004 at 03:37:50PM +0100, Petter Reinholdtsen wrote: > [Jeff Bailey] > > I'm curious, though. The new hotplug seems to have the goal of > > replacing discover. It may make sense to use that instead of > > discover2 on 2.6 based systems (since it's likely that everyone will > > want it anyway) > > I've experienced some problems with hotplug earlier, as it is using > the info in /lib/modules/<version>/modules.*map directly. If more > than one module claim to support a given PCI id, it seem to pick any > one of them. The tools having a separate hw database have an > advantage here, where the maintainers can select which of these > modules to use for a given PCI id. Is this problem solved with newer > hotplug versions?
